Robert Lawson Mr. Beaver liked to call them the Three Musketeers. To be sure, three friends could not have been more inseparable or more adventurous then Edward Rabbit, Hoppy Toad, and Joe Possum. Sometimes, all that energy and spirit of adventure got the better of them. They had to learn, for instance, that such mechanical gadgets as automobiles and roller skates are better left for people. But they found other ways to get around. With a canoe like the Discoverer they could play hooky, rescue themselves from a circus, or even set out in search of the Wild West.
"This is Robert Lawson at his very best, giving us in an engaging story with inimitable pictures more unforgettable animal characters to place alongside those in Rabbit Hill. Loveable, mischievous and wise, they will be loved by small children everywhere." -Chicago Tribune
